The American Eye Study Club (AESC) is a prestigious membership organization that was established in 1956 by a group of leading ophthalmologists. It provides a platform for young leaders in the field to share ideas and discuss the latest developments in a scientific and social setting. The club prides itself on its diverse membership, encompassing professionals from various academic, geographic, and practice backgrounds.


In addition to fostering intellectual exchange, the AESC also values family participation, ensuring a warm and inclusive environment. Membership in the AESC includes approximately 60 active members, who, after 10 years, transition to Emeritus status. Members can retain their Emeritus status indefinitely and may move to retired status when they cease active practice.


The club has a rich history, with an impressive list of past presidents and annual meeting locations. It has also established two distinguished lectures and an award in honor of prominent members.
